Join CCW for an exciting opportunity to participate in a Zoom discussion with Juliet Grames CC’05 about her bestselling novel, The Seven or Eight Deaths of Stella Fortuna.

Grames will also speak on the lost history of southern Italy, and how the past can be recreated through oral history and folk tradition. Participants will have a chance to ask questions and will enjoy a special performance by a surprise guest in celebration of Southern Italian culture!

Zoom meeting information provided upon registration.

Juliet Grames CC'05's debut novel, The Seven or Eight Deaths of Stella Fortuna (Ecco/HarperCollins), revolves around a century in the life of an Italian-American family, their emigration from Calabria, and the blood feud between their matriarch and her sister. The novel, which celebrates often-overlooked southern Italian history and culture, was a national bestseller and has been translated into ten languages.
